Site Description:
The Emergency Entrance at University Hospital is a critical access point operating 24/7. This position focuses on strict access control, visitor screening, and monitoring of high-traffic areas to maintain a safe and controlled environment. Officers must demonstrate strong communication skills, situational awareness, and the ability to manage sensitive situations with professionalism and discretion.

The day-to-day work activities of an Access Control Security Guard include, but are not limited, the following duties:
- Control entry and access to the hospital
- Ensuring compliance with the standards, rules, and regulations at the hospital
- Able to use tact and diplomacy in dealings across a range of settings and situations
- Ability to maintain and enforce access control procedures
- Solid understanding of emergency and standard operating procedures
- Deal with trespassers and unauthorized persons found on the property, in a fair and safe manner, by enforcing the Trespass to Property Act
- De-escalate emergency/crisis situations
Job Requirements:
- Must possess Ontario Security Guard License
- First Aid & CPR – Level C (WSIB approved)
- Post-Secondary education in law enforcement from a recognized institution or equivalent experience is preferred
- Physical Demands include excessive walking and standing
- Utilize radio and computer applications for communicating site activities
- Watch for and report irregularities by completing incident reports, such as security breaches, facility and safety hazards, and emergency situations; contact emergency responders, such as police, fire, and/or ambulance personnel, as required.
- Superior written and verbal communication skills.
- Demonstrated punctuality and reliability, tact, and diplomacy.
- Perform miscellaneous job-related duties as assigned.
- Must be able to provide certifications in Use of Force (UOF) and Management of Aggressive Behavior (MOAB)
- Applicants lacking these certifications can opt into Paladin's UoF/MOAB training program prior to their onboarding training to ensure they meet the requirements of the position
- Please be aware: The UoF/MOAB training is not paid as it is a pre-requisite; however, Paladin will cover all of the costs of the training with a 6-month commitment to the position/availability
- Authorized to legally work in Canada
